How do you feel when your teacher asks you to work on a group project with other students? Do you like to work together with others or work alone?
The program for International Student Assessment(PISA), which aims to evaluate education systems worldwide by testing the skills and knowledge of 15-year-old students, carried out a survey of students’ ability to work together in groups. They found that students who do well on tests by themselves are also likely to be better at working with other people.
This finding was true for many countries. Students in Japan, South Korea, Finland and Canada, where test scores are high, also did well in working together to solve problems. But this was not the case for every country. Chinese students, who usually can get high scores as well, displayed just common collaborative(合作的)skills.
“One reason might be that Chinese parents and teachers focus too much on grades, said Zhao Zhongxin, former vice president ( 前副经理 ) of the Chinese Family Education Association. “Students have a lot of exam pressure and they regard school as a place for competition.”
“However, collaborative skills are very important for preparing students today’s society,” he added. “Luckily, more Chinese parents and teachers are realizing the importance of this and are thinking of ways to help students improve it.”
Another interesting finding from the PISA survey was that girls are most likely to be better than boys at working together. They said girls show more positive attitude( 态 度 ) toward relationships, which means they are more willing to listen to others’ opinions.
PISA also found that the classroom environment tends to influence how well students collaborate. In classes where there are a lot of activities that require communication, such as class discussion, students would have better attitudes towards collaborating.

Have you ever had an experience where you meet someone new, learn their name and think to yourself, “Wow, they really look just like their names!” What does this mean, exactly? Scientists are suggesting that humans perhaps are able to connect people’s names with their appearance, and can even guess someone’s name based on how they look.
Researchers at the Hebrew University of Jerusalem in Israel collected thousands of photos of people’s faces. They provided each photo with four names. Then, they asked volunteers to guess which of the four names was correct.
The volunteers were able to guess the right name 38 percent of the time. It seems that humans are able to know certain characteristics of faces that can give them useful information about someone’s name, Reader’s Digest reported.
However, this only works when we’re looking at names within our own culture. In addition, the volunteers were not as good at guessing the real names of people who use nicknames ( 昵 称 ) more often than their real names. This shows that a person’s appearance is influenced by their name only if they use it often.
This kind of face-name matching happens “because of a process of self-fulfilling prediction, as we become what other people expect us to become,” Ruth Mayo from the university told science news website Eurek Alert.
Some scientists studies have shown that gender and race (种族) stereotypes (刻板印象) can influence a person’s appearance. The researchers believe there are also similar stereotypes about names. For example, people are able to think that men named Bob should have rounder faces because the word itself looks round. People may think that women named Rose are beautiful. They expect them to be delicate (娇弱的) and to be what women are like, just like the flower they are named for.
